Ticket #— Floor 9 Opening Prep, Brindlemoor House

Hi facilities folks, Floor 9 opens to staff next Monday and we need a few things squared away before then. Lift access is live, but the two side doors by the kitchenette are still on the old lock config — please reprogram them before Friday. Also, signage for the quiet rooms hasn't arrived, so pop up the temporary printed ones for now. Until the badge readers sync, the interim door code for Floor 9 is below.

door code, bajop-bajog: bdg-DSWAC-43621

// Circuit breaker threshold for calls to the Quellar Pricing API.
// If Quellar returns five consecutive 5xx responses, the breaker
// opens and we serve cached quotes for ninety seconds before a
// half-open probe. Don't lower this without talking to the Margate
// platform team first — Quellar's staging tier flaps often, and an
// aggressive threshold caused a cascade during the Brindlewood
// launch. The value below was last tuned in the Ravenhall sprint.
// The build that validated this tuning is recorded here.

pipeline stamp: htk9_ce63042d9

# Larkspur CI — Environments

Heads up for the security review: our build agents in the Tovrell pool have been drifting up to 40 seconds apart, which breaks signature timestamp checks on Larkspur artifacts. We now sync every agent against the internal Meridack time service at boot. For audit purposes, here's the current environment configuration.

config for kagup-hahig:
druwyn:
  pin: 2801
  metrics_host: metrics.druwyn.zemvarlabs.internal
  tenant: sorius
  seal: seal_798a43d7

Onboarding: log compaction in Burrowmill, our internal message queue. Compaction keeps only the latest record per key, which is why consumers rebuilding state must tolerate gaps in offsets. Compaction runs when a segment's dirty ratio exceeds 0.4, and tombstones persist for 24 hours before removal — size your replay windows accordingly. Before the sync, please skim the compaction design notes and open questions gathered on the internal page.

dashboard of yaguf-hahig = https://grafana.urlaqworks.test/secrets